Ahmadinejad's Nominee for Interior Ministry is a veteran Revolutionary Guard

Mullahs' President Mahmoud Ahmadinejad nominated Sadeq Mahsouli to succeed Ali Kordan -- an infamous figure in the diploma-gate scandal -- as the next Interior Minister.
Mahsouli was among the most criminal commanders of the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) with a long record in the suppression and murder of the people of East and West Azerbaijan provinces.
He was the IRGC commander for the country's Fifth Military District (East and West Azerbaijan), commander of the IRGC Sixth Special Expeditionary Division and for some time the IRGC's inspector-general.
As the city governor for Orumieh and deputy governor of West Azerbaijan, he played a major role in the suppression of anti-government uprisings in the province.
Aside from being Ahmedinejad's closest confident, Mahsouli was his commander while they both served as members of IRGC's hit squads in the 1980s and 90s with Ramadan Garrison -- located in west Iran across the boarder with Iraq. The unit's special mission was to assassinate Iranian dissidents abroad.
However, 1980s assassin turned businessman and made millions of dollars with the help of lucrative projects offered to him by the IRGC for his services to the mullahs' Supreme Leader Ali Khamenei. He has earned a nick name among his cronies as Brig. Gen. "billionaire."
